I have had three different 802.11AC wireless setups and they all have the same problem so I know it is not an issue with my current setup so I decided to post this question here in the general questions section so here it goes.
My hardware is as follows:
Cable modem connected to internet
CAT 6 Ethernet cable from cable modem to First ASUS RT-AC66U Wireless 802.11AC Router
CAT 6 Ethernet cable from AUS Router to Main PC
Second ASUS RT-AC66U Wireless 802.11AC Router setup up as Wireless Bridge
CAT 6 Ethernet cable from Second Router to Home Theater PC
CAT 6 Ethernet cable from Second Router to Synology Diskstation DS +1812 networked hard disk
Here is my problem - if I log into my "Main PC" and try to transfer files wirelessly from the "Main PC" to the Synology networked hard disk, I get transfer speeds around 4 MBps, way too slow. But if I login into my "Home Theater PC" and initiate the same transfer from my "Main PC" to the "Synology", I get a 40 MBps transfer speed. Am I missing something? Is there a setting I need to change?
